R. Żuberek is a scholar working on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ials,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and Mechanical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, R. Żuberek has authored 103 papers receiving a total of 724 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 87 papers in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ials, 64 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and 58 papers in Mechanical Engineering. Recurrent topics in R. Żuberek's work include Magnetic Properties and Applications (76 papers), Magnetic properties of thin films (63 papers) and Metallic Glasses and Amorphous Alloys (54 papers). R. Żuberek is often cited by papers focused on Magnetic Properties and Applications (76 papers), Magnetic properties of thin films (63 papers) and Metallic Glasses and Amorphous Alloys (54 papers). R. Żuberek collaborates with scholars based in Poland, Spain and France. R. Żuberek's co-authors include H. Szymczak, A. Ślawska‐Waniewska, K. Fronc, T. Kulik, J. González, R. Krishnan, M.R.J. Gibbs, A. Nabiałek, T. Szumiata and M. Gutowski and has published in prestigious journals such as Physical review. B, Condensed matter, Journal of Applied Physics and Physical Review B.
